GVB to pay former bus driver €45,000 for mishandling stalking case

An Amsterdam court has ordered public transport company GVB to pay €45,000 to former bus driver Tanja Nolting for failing to protect her from workplace stalking by an ex-partner who was also a colleague. The judge ruled that the company neglected its duty of care by dismissing the harassment as a private matter and mishandling Nolting's reintegration, which eventually led to her departure from the company.
